+.Sh NAME
+.Nm crypto
+.Nd OpenCrypto algorithms
+.Sh SYNOPSIS
+In the kernel configuration file:
+.Cd "device crypto"
+.Pp
+Or load the crypto.ko module.
+.Sh DESCRIPTION
+The following cryptographic algorithms that are part of the OpenCrypto
+framework have the following requirements.
+.Pp
+Cipher algorithms:
+.Bl -tag -width ".Dv CRYPTO_AES_CBC"
+.It Dv CRYPTO_AES_CBC
+.Bl -tag -width "Block size :" -compact -offset indent
+.It IV size :
+16
+.It Block size :
+16
+.It Key size :
+16, 24 or 32
+.El
+.Pp
+This algorithm implements Cipher-block chaining.
+.It Dv CRYPTO_AES_NIST_GCM_16
+.Bl -tag -width "Block size :" -compact -offset indent
+.It IV size :
+12
+.It Block size :
+1
+.It Key size :
+16, 24 or 32
+.It Digest size :
+16
+.El
+.Pp
+This algorithm implements Galois/Counter Mode.
+This is the cipher part of an AEAD
+.Pq Authenticated Encryption with Associated Data
+mode.
+This requires use of the use of a proper authentication mode, one of
+.Dv CRYPTO_AES_128_NIST_GMAC ,
+.Dv CRYPTO_AES_192_NIST_GMAC
+or
+.Dv CRYPTO_AES_256_NIST_GMAC ,
+that corresponds with the number of bits in the key that you are using.
+.Pp
+The associated data (if any) must be provided by the authentication mode op.
+The authentication tag will be read/written from/to the offset crd_inject
+specified in the descriptor for the authentication mode.
+.Pp
+Note: You must provide an IV on every call.
+.It Dv CRYPTO_AES_ICM
+.Bl -tag -width "Block size :" -compact -offset indent
+.It IV size :
+16
+.It Block size :
+1 (aesni), 16 (software)
+.It Key size :
+16, 24 or 32
+.El
+.Pp
+This algorithm implements Integer Counter Mode.
+This is similar to what most people call counter mode, but instead of the
+counter being split into a nonce and a counter part, then entire nonce is
+used as the initial counter.
+This does mean that if a counter is required that rolls over at 32 bits,
+the transaction need to be split into two parts where the counter rolls over.
+The counter incremented as a 128-bit big endian number.
+.Pp
+Note: You must provide an IV on every call.
+.It Dv CRYPTO_AES_XTS
+.Bl -tag -width "Block size :" -compact -offset indent
+.It IV size :
+16
+.It Block size :
+16
+.It Key size :
+32 or 64
+.El
+.Pp
+This algorithm implements XEX Tweakable Block Cipher with Ciphertext Stealing
+as defined in NIST SP 800-38E.
+.Pp
+NOTE: The ciphertext stealing part is not implemented which is why this cipher
+is listed as having a block size of 16 instead of 1.
+.El
